This is an automated email from the git hooks/post-receive script. It was generated because a ref change was pushed to the repository containing the project gfxprim.git.
The branch, master has been updated via 0b9e5475cc8db3e7b8c5555744c7b29ca3dbbed3 (commit) via 4315c42da30f2217b38c6d63862211dcd78db68c (commit) via 8d81d6e61f6efa9d6782397a95890e500cd547e4 (commit) from 09faee6cdc1fd7401ed8343a7539d4f547a5b7ec (commit)
Those revisions listed above that are new to this repository have not appeared on any other notification email; so we list those revisions in full, below.
- Log ----------------------------------------------------------------- http://repo.or.cz/w/gfxprim.git/commit/0b9e5475cc8db3e7b8c5555744c7b29ca3dbb...
commit 0b9e5475cc8db3e7b8c5555744c7b29ca3dbbed3 Merge: 4315c42 09faee6 Author: Cyril Hrubis metan@ucw.cz Date: Sun May 6 18:03:27 2012 +0200
Merge ssh://repo.or.cz/srv/git/gfxprim
http://repo.or.cz/w/gfxprim.git/commit/4315c42da30f2217b38c6d63862211dcd78db...
commit 4315c42da30f2217b38c6d63862211dcd78db68c Author: Cyril Hrubis metan@ucw.cz Date: Sun May 6 15:03:32 2012 +0200
build: Add core linker flags to --libs.
diff --git a/configure b/configure index 5d25409..aa1d268 100755 --- a/configure +++ b/configure @@ -192,7 +192,7 @@ def write_gfxprim_config(cfg, libs): f.write('t--help) echo "$USAGE"; exit 0;;n') f.write('t--list-modules) echo "%s"; exit 0;;n' % ' '.join(modules)) f.write('t--cflags) echo -n "-I/usr/include/GP/ ";;n') - f.write('t--libs) echo -n "-lGP ";;n') + f.write('t--libs) echo -n "-lGP %s ";;n' % libs.get_linker_flags('core'))
# ldflags for specific modules @@ -240,7 +240,7 @@ if __name__ == '__main__': [header_exists, "X11/Xlib.h"], "", "-lX11", {"backends"}], ["freetype", "A high-quality and portable font engine", - [header_exists, "ft2build.h"], "", "`freetype-config --libs`", {"text"}]], cfg) + [header_exists, "ft2build.h"], "", "`freetype-config --libs`", {"core"}]], cfg)
parser = OptionParser();
http://repo.or.cz/w/gfxprim.git/commit/8d81d6e61f6efa9d6782397a95890e500cd54...
commit 8d81d6e61f6efa9d6782397a95890e500cd547e4 Author: Cyril Hrubis metan@ucw.cz Date: Sun May 6 14:54:23 2012 +0200
build: The backends module needs to add -lGP_backends.
diff --git a/configure b/configure index a83d654..5d25409 100755 --- a/configure +++ b/configure @@ -191,14 +191,18 @@ def write_gfxprim_config(cfg, libs): # General switches cflags and ldflags f.write('t--help) echo "$USAGE"; exit 0;;n') f.write('t--list-modules) echo "%s"; exit 0;;n' % ' '.join(modules)) - f.write('t--cflags) echo -n "-I/usr/include/GP/";;n') - f.write('t--libs) echo -n "-lGP";;n') + f.write('t--cflags) echo -n "-I/usr/include/GP/ ";;n') + f.write('t--libs) echo -n "-lGP ";;n')
# ldflags for specific modules for i in modules: - f.write('t--libs-%s) echo -n "%s";;n' % - (i, libs.get_linker_flags(i))) + ldflags = '' + if i == 'backends': + ldflags += '-lGP_backends ' + ldflags += libs.get_linker_flags(i) + f.write('t--libs-%s) echo -n "%s ";;n' % (i, ldflags)) +
f.write('tesacntshiftndonenechon') f.close()
-----------------------------------------------------------------------
Summary of changes: configure | 14 +++++++++----- 1 files changed, 9 insertions(+), 5 deletions(-)
repo.or.cz automatic notification. Contact project admin jiri.bluebear.dluhos@gmail.com if you want to unsubscribe, or site admin admin@repo.or.cz if you receive no reply.